Inside Llewyn Davis (2013)
can I get my money back?
What a cruel joke! We thought this was a pretty terrible movie. Perhaps if you are a lover of folk music trivia you can find subtle meanings. It was lost on us and we are big 60's folk music fans although we did enjoy the soundtrack. There were no characters in this film that we liked or cared about. Of course folk singers did have trials and tribulations in pursuing their craft but they were people with values, nothing like the singer portrayed here. The plot meandered from one mean vignette to another. The John Goodman sequence wasn't funny or deep, it was just annoying. The hallmark seemed to be that everyone when off on an irrational rant for whatever reason. The use of profanity was overdone. It further belittled the characters. I'm shocked that the film has apparently gotten some measure of critical acclaim.
I was certainly expecting something clever and amusing. This was not it.
The Beaver (2011)
Painful to watch, a disappointment
I really like Jody Foster and wanted to like this movie that she has been making the rounds on talk shows for. I found Gibson's character and his family totally unsympathetic, just sad. The therapeutic puppet strategy which I believe is used often with children just didn't seem fitting to me. The whole thing seemed too strange and too painful to watch. The plot meandered all over the map and didn't hold my interest. The flopping between comedy and dark drama was unsettling and jarring. Very unrealistic to my thinking. Perhaps a less rough hewn actor or cuter puppet might have carried it better. Some of the puppet sequences seemed twilight zone creepy. I came out feeling unsatisfied and depressed.
